We report an ethylene glycol-mediated one-pot synthesis with post-annealing treatment of uniformlydistributed TiO2 nanospheres on nanosheet-based a-Fe 2O3 (hematite) hierarchical flowers. The present samples were characterized by several analytical techniques including field emission scanning electron microscopy (FE-SEM), transmission electron microscopy (TEM), X-ray diffraction (XRD), X-ray photoelectron spectroscopy (XPS) and thermogravimetric analysis (TGA). Enhancement in photocatalytic efficiency with magnetically-assisted recovery could be realized in the present TiO 2/a-Fe2O3 nanocomposites due to the high crystallinity of anatase TiO2 and the recyclability was resulted from ferromagnetics of hematite. © 2013 Elsevier B.V.
